Chillicothe, MO
Grand River Technical School admits nearly every applicant who meets its basic requirements — roughly 100 of every 100 applicants are accepted.
Source: IPEDS Admissions survey
The acceptance rate has risen 25 percentage points since 2019, from 75% to 100% — it has become less selective.
| Fall | Applicants | Admitted | Enrolled | Acceptance |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 71 | 53 | 42 | 75% |
| 2020 | 59 | 50 | 37 | 85% |
| 2021 | 55 | 54 | 45 | 98% |
| 2022 | 55 | 55 | 50 | 100% |
| 2023 | 31 | 31 | 31 | 100% |
Fall 2023 applicants
8 of 8 women and 23 of 23 men were admitted.
